How Crypto Casinos Work

Wallet Integration-- Players connect a Web3‑compatible wallet (MetaMask, Trust Wallet, etc) to the casino's frontend. Smart Contract Betting-- When a bet is placed, the quantity is locked in a wise contract that immediately deals with the outcome based upon an agreed‑upon random seed. Provably Fair Generation-- Most platforms integrate your house's seed with the player's seed to produce a hash that determines the outcome, then expose the seeds so the computation can be inspected. Settlement-- Winning bets sets off an on‑chain transfer back to the player's address; losing bets are tape-recorded on‑chain for audit purposes.

Since the whole lifecycle-- bet placement, result generation, and payout-- is governed by code, there is minimal scope for manual intervention, which reduces the capacity for scams.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)

1. Are crypto casino video games legal everywhere?

No. The legality depends upon your jurisdiction's stance on both online gambling and cryptocurrency deals. Constantly examine local policies before registering.

2. How do I know a game is truly "provably reasonable?"

Many platforms show a "fairness" or "verification" link. You can input the server crypto casino no KYC seed, customer seed, and nonce into a cryptographic verifier (or utilize the website's built‑in tool) to confirm the result matches the published result.

3. Can I play without a large crypto balance?

Yes. Many casinos accept micro‑deposits-- you can bet as little as a couple of cents worth of token. Just guarantee the networkfee does not outweigh the bet size.

4. What takes place if I lose access to my wallet?

If you lose your seed phrase, you lose access to your funds completely. Keep backups in secure, 离线 places (e.g., paperwallet or hardware vault). Some platforms offeraccount recovery through email or 2FA, but they can not recuperate the underlying wallet.

5. Do crypto casinos offer perks like standard sites?

Definitely. Welcome bonus offers, reload rewards, and cash‑back deals are typical. Nevertheless, most crypto perks featured "betting requirements" expressed in tokens rather than fiat-- constantly read the terms.

6. How are fees structured?

Most sites charge no deposit charges; you pay just the network gas charge for the blockchain you utilize. Withdrawal charges vary depending upon the property and current network congestion. Some platforms add a small flat service charge.

7. Is it safe to keep my funds on the casino platform?

It's usually much safer to keep just what you plan to play. For bigger holdings, move them back to an individual wallet or hardware ledger. Leading casinos utilize cold‑storage and insurance coverage, however keeping big balances on any hot‑wallet constantly brings risk.

8. What are "live dealership" crypto games?

These stream a genuine human dealership in a studio, while bets are put and settled by means of cryptocurrency on the backend. The experience mirrors land‑based gambling establishments, but permits for borderless betting.
